academic having to do with a school.
anomaly an act or instance of differing from the usual pattern, form, or type; peculiarity; abnormality.
carat a unit of weight for diamonds and other gems, equal to one-fifth of a gram.
concede to admit the truth or justice of.
deficient lacking something needed.
exceed to go beyond or do more than.
intent1 plan; aim; intention.
miserly stingy or penurious.
offensive not pleasant; disagreeable.
plush a type of cloth having long, soft, thick fibers.
resort a place where people go to relax and have fun while on vacation.
seismic of, concerning, or resulting from an earthquake.
smug confident of or satisfied with oneself to the point of annoying other people; complacent.
temperate having neither extremely hot nor extremely cold temperatures and mild weather.
waive to forgo or give up (a right, claim, or privilege).
